International Women’s Day, Empowering Women

International Women’s Day celebrated on the 8th of March serves as a cornerstone for celebrating women’s accomplishments, amplifying discussions on gender equality, advocating for swifter progress towards parity, and mobilizing resources for women-centric initiatives.

This year’s theme is ‘Invest in women: Accelerate Progress’ which means investing in gender equality and women’s empowerment, an incredibly smart investment to generate economic growth, food security, income opportunities, and better lives, particularly in rural areas where most of the world’s poorest live.

The story of women’s struggle for equality belongs to no single feminist nor any one organization but to the collective efforts of all who care about human rights.

International Women’s Day should be an everyday celebration to make a positive difference in women.

The celebration calls for action to break down barriers, challenge stereotypes, and create environments where all women are valued and respected.

Participating in International Women’s Day can drive recognition for women. “When we inspire others to understand and value women’s inclusion, we forge a better world. And when women themselves are inspired to be included, there’s a sense of belonging, relevance, and empowerment,” the organizers said.

Women still face challenges getting equal pay and leadership positions because women are seen as vulnerable but that should not be the case.

Africa needs to ensure that across the continent, women’s rights are enshrined in law and enforced by authorities. Many African countries sign up for international or regional treaties but do not implement them. Governments need to institute and enforce legal rights and put in place enabling policies and regulations that drive progress toward gender.
